About The Position

The Project Manager is responsible for leading and managing multi-disciplinary teams on transportation and municipal projects while driving business development and client/project/quality/service management. They oversee all aspects of projects, from preliminary engineering to construction, including design, documentation, cost estimation, and QA/QC. This candidate will be collaborating with engineers, planners, technicians, and clients to ensure successful project delivery and client satisfaction. Required experience includes an established career in Civil Engineering with diverse project scope and expertise in relevant design areas.

Requirements

  • Registered as a Professional Engineer.
  • Experience in business development, marketing, and sales skills.
  • Understanding of ODOT Project Development Processes (Design criteria, standards, and specifications).
  • Experience working on ODOT, ODOT LAP, and/or municipal roadway projects.
  • Experience working with ODOT and Communities, such as Cost and Scheduling Engineers, County Highway Engineers, City Managers, DPW, and City/Village Councils.
  • Experience with Open Roads Designer/MicroStation/Geopak/AutoTurn.
